SoraApp.com. Using the digital library, Sora- The student reading app, in the K-12 classroom to help address gaps in student learning and provide intervention strategies. App settings include Dyslexic font and adjustable contrast, font, size and speed for audio. Additional in app helps include word definition, bookmarking, and note taking. Reading and listening uses in the classroom could include individuals or groups, including classroom sets. Content possibilities include read-along (words on the page highlighted with narration), high-low (& peers won’t know), decodable/phonics books, and ESL/non-English reads. Social and emotional learning books include self-help books as well as empowering fiction/nonfiction novels as mirrors and windows. Multiple genre possibilities grab students' interest.
